Membership Information
How do I join Tri-Beta? 1. I'm so glad you asked. First, you should talk to a Tri-Beta officer or Dr. Jones about joining. 2. Next, sign up and pay your dues and membership fee. Each semester dues are $5 (what a deal!!!!). Membership fees vary depending on the number of biology classes you have had: If you have taken less than 3 biology classes, then you can join as an Associate member; if you have taken 3 or more biology classes and hold a cumulative GPA of 3.0 or better in those classes, then you can become an Honors member. Associate members pay a ONE-TIME fee of $40; Honors members pay a ONE-TIME fee of $50. Also, Associate members can later upgrade to Honors-if they meet the requirements above-by paying an upgrade fee of $15. Advantages to Joining Beta Beta Beta Biological Honor Society: 1. Tri-Beta members have the opportunity to become acquainted with members of the Biology department faculty, which will be advantageous when students want to participate in research activities and ask for letters of recommendation. 2. Tri-Beta active members are nationally recognized as honor students in the field of Biology and have the opportunity to wear Tri-Beta honor cords at graduation. 3. Tri-Beta members are a group of friends who participate in a variety of functions together including 4. Tri-Beta annually sponsors 8-12 speakers who address various topics including the fields of medicine, dentistry, and allied health, research in biology, and professions in biology. These lectures are one of the many reasons our chapter has been recognized nationally several times as the “Outstanding Chapter in the Nation”. 5. Tri-Beta members are often the first to be considered when the Biology Department considers students for special recognition (e.g. nominations for Who’s Who, Nominations for the Presidential Award, Head of the River Ranch Scholarships, invitations to the Moon Lecture BBQ, departmental jobs, etc.) 6. Tri-Beta members have access to our large office facilities in the basement of the Cavness building for studying for classes, studying for the MCAT or DAT using Tri-Beta study materials, looking through our large selection of books and journals, or just a place to relax during classes. 7. Tri-Beta members are granted first choice in selecting among the science books donated by professors, students, etc. prior to Tri-Beta’s annual book sale. 8. Tri-Beta members receive subscriptions to the national Tri-Beta journal BIOS and our chapter newsletter Beta Bylines. 9. Tri-Beta members receive a certificate and membership card attesting to their membership, as well as a Tri-Beta decal for their automobile. |
